The PIC16F72X/PIC16LF72X
capability of storing eight 14-bit words in its data
latches. The data latches are internal to the
PIC16F72X/PIC16LF72X devices and are only used
for programming. The data latches allow the user to
program up to eight program words with a single Begin
Externally Timed Programming or Begin Internally
Timed Programming command. The Load Program
Data or the Load Configuration Word command is used
to load a single data latch. The data latch will hold the
data until Begin Externally Timed Programming or
Begin Internally Timed Programming command is
given.

The data latches are aligned with the 3 LSb of the PC.
The address of the PC, at the time the Begin Externally
Timed Programming or Begin Internally Timed
Programming command is given, will determine which
location(s) in memory are written. Writes can not cross
a physical eight-word boundary.
attempting to write from PC 0002h-0009h will result in
data being written to 0008h-000Fh.
If more than 8 data latches are written without a Begin
Externally Timed Programming or Begin Internally
Timed Programming command the data in the data
latches will be overwritten. The following diagrams
show the recommended flowcharts for programming.
